C20H15Cl2N7O — CID 142425503
1-(6-chloro-4-cyclopropylquinolin-3-yl)-3-[5-chloro-6-(triazol-2-yl)-3-pyridinyl]urea (PubChem CID 142425503) has the molecular formula C20H15Cl2N7O and a molecular weight of 440.29 g/mol. Its IUPAC name is 1-(6-chloro-4-cyclopropylquinolin-3-yl)-3-[5-chloro-6-(triazol-2-yl)-3-pyridinyl]urea.
| Compound Name | 1-(6-chloro-4-cyclopropylquinolin-3-yl)-3-[5-chloro-6-(triazol-2-yl)-3-pyridinyl]urea |
|---|---|
| PubChem CID | 142425503 |
| Molecular Formula | C20H15Cl2N7O |
| Molecular Weight | 440.29 g/mol |
| Exact Mass | 439.07 |
| IUPAC Name | 1-(6-chloro-4-cyclopropylquinolin-3-yl)-3-[5-chloro-6-(triazol-2-yl)-3-pyridinyl]urea |
| SMILES | O=C(Nc1cnc(-n2nccn2)c(Cl)c1)Nc1cnc2ccc(Cl)cc2c1C1CC1 |
| InChI | InChI=1S/C20H15Cl2N7O/c21-12-3-4-16-14(7-12)18(11-1-2-11)17(10-23-16)28-20(30)27-13-8-15(22)19(24-9-13)29-25-5-6-26-29/h3-11H,1-2H2,(H2,27,28,30) |
| InChIKey | JROMLJWGZZEFRO-UHFFFAOYSA-N |
| XLogP | 5.04 |
| TPSA | 97.62 Ų |
| H-Bond Donors | 2 |
| H-Bond Acceptors | 6 |
| Rotatable Bonds | 4 |
| Heavy Atoms | 30 |
